Infectious disease is one of the major health problems in Indonesia. The incidence of pneumonia in infants at the working area of Community Health Centre Semin is 9,1% cases. The purpose of this study was to analyze the association of environmental house factors with pneumonia incidence in children under five years at the working area of Community Health Centre Semin I GunungKidul District 2017. This study used observational analytic research with case control approach, discovered populations of infants in the group of some 126 cases and the control group as much as 1.710. The sample is selected by simple random sampling, with sample of 90 respondents which fulfill the criteria as research subject. The data analysis used were univariate and analytic bivariate using chi square statistic test with significance value ( = 5%) and univariate analysis showed 12.2% of respondents aged 26 years; 47.8% respondents with recent high school education; 62% as housewives; and 54.4% of income
